A Douglas man has been remanded in custody after being charged with GBH and being in possession of an offensive weapon.
29-year-old Mark William Thomas Bell is accused of GBH with intent against a 23-year-old woman and of having a pole in public.
Both offences are said to have taken place on May 29th in a lane near to Demesne Road in Douglas – the woman suffered serious injuries and was hospitalised.
Mr Bell didn’t enter a plea – he will next appear before the Magistrates’ Court on July 3rd via live link from Jurby.
A committal date for July 29th has also been set.
